Chapter 6: Revelations
Landyr leaned back in the chair and looked up at the ceiling. Everything about his home and time has changed. He never realized this when he took the assignment. There was too much going on for him to even stop to consider this. Dumbledore started to speak again.
"I could send you back to the year 2998, if you want to leave now, but before you decide I want you to hear me out. Besides, there are many questions that you want answered. The journal had the full details about the impending war. I was quite shocked that I was killed. I was even more shocked at how Mr. Potter died. We cannot let that happen again. There was a recent entry that was written right before you were sent back in time. It had a full description of your wand and a certain power that you have. I knew you had a very powerful wand to create a time vortex, but I didn't know it was that powerful."
Landyr blinked a few time, and then said, "But I didn't create the time vortex, you're environmental memory did. You ... he ... er ... it pointed a wand me and I was sent to this time."
"You are half correct. I will try to explain." Dumbledore paused to think for a second. "I have been a Professor here for more than sixty years. That leaves a kind of an imprint on the environment. Muggles, or non-magic folk, can leave an imprint as well. Since I am powerful in magic, my memory was able to stay in a human form for a few days. It decided to record the events here so that it may never be forgotten. Then it faded. A thousand years later you come around. Your magic was able to give my memory strength again. I might add that one must be extremely powerful to revive a thousand year old memory. Anyways, you gave it enough power to send you to gather the materials to make a powerful wand. The wand gave you more power when it was finished. My memory was able to use your power to create the time vertex. What is the last thing that you remember before you appeared in the Entrance Hall?"
"I saw your memory start to fade."
"Exactly! You were leaving that time and place. You were the only thing keeping the memory around, so once you started to leave, the memory couldn't hold form anymore and began to fade."
"So ... I actually opened the time vertex?"
"Yes, mind, you didn't call the magic yourself. The magic was called on your behalf and used the power of you and your wand." Dumbledore paused. "My memory surprised me when it used Phoenix tears for a varnish on your wand."
"I'm sorry. I don't understand that."
"Phoenix tears have healing abilities if applied directly to a wound. When they are used as a varnish, the wand gives the user regeneration abilities. The wand will give the user more vitality, strength, and magic ability. In theory, one could do magic non-stop for an eternity without needing rest." Dumbledore smiled at that last bit he said.
Landyr looking stunned, "A regenerating wand! Wow!" A thought dawned over him and it showed on his face, "What did you mean by a certain power that I had?"
"Ah, now we get down to the heart of the matter. In an effort to keep Mr. Potter from dying I would like you to teach him ..."
"Teach him?" interrupted Landyr hotly. "How can I teach something that I have renounced?"
"Renounced?" asked Dumbledore.
"Yes!" Landyr stood up and walked to the other end of the office and folded his arms. "You don't understand the time that I am from." Landyr turned around to face Dumbledore. "It's taught in our history lessons. A thousand years ago on a Friday, a person by the name of Petunia Dursley was murdered by a green light in a grocery store. People had no idea what new technology could kill a person with out leaving any trace. The only other case like it in history was the murder of the Riddles. Vernon Dursley gave a speech which claimed that the freak who killed his wife was a wizard by the name of Lord Voldemort. He also said that Lord Voldemort wanted to be the ruler of the world. This news spread like wildfire all around the world. It was a general consensus that all wizards and witches should be wiped off the face of the planet. Governments went into a state of National Emergency and mobilized all the armed forces. Then the next day, a war broke out. There were a lot of people killed. No one knew how to defend themselves against these people that could shoot a deadly green light. The armies where able to take them out, but it took many Soldiers' lives and a lot of firepower to do so. People panicked. To keep a war like this from ever happening again, anybody that showed magical signs was killed, even babies. That practice continued up to my time. You see? I had to withhold my magic abilities, or I might have been killed. I knew I could do magic since I was very young. I could do some things with out a wand very well."
"Exactly! You have the power to control the magic force itself. You can turn it off completely, or amplify it to the point where any spell or charm is possible to do. I need you to teach this power to all of the DA. If we win, Magic will exist in the future when you go back, so you won't need to hide it any more. However, if we fail, you can go back to renouncing it, if you wish."
Landyr sat back down in the chair, and closed his eyes to think. He opened them again and said in a small voice, "All right. I'll do it."
